Kutewadi Population - Bid, Maharashtra
Kutewadi is a medium size village located in Patoda Taluka of Bid district, Maharashtra with total 125 families residing. The Kutewadi village has population of 640 of which 349 are males while 291 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kutewadi village population of children with age 0-6 is 107 which makes up 16.72 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kutewadi village is 834 which is lower than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Kutewadi as per census is 845, lower than Maharashtra average of 894.
Kutewadi village has lower liter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Kutewadi village was 66.60 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Kutewadi Male literacy stands at 74.57 % while female literacy rate was 57.02 %.

Kutewadi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 125 | - | - |
Population | 640 | 349 | 291 |
Child (0-6) | 107 | 58 | 49 |
Schedule Caste | 102 | 52 | 50 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 66.60 % | 74.57 % | 57.02 % |
Total Workers | 391 | 209 | 182 |
Main Worker | 388 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 3 | 2 | 1 |
